Guillaume Gombault is a contemporary artist whose work navigates the intersection of imagination and reality. From a young age, he was drawn to imaginary worlds—places just out of reach, yet vividly present in the mind. These inner landscapes first took shape in drawings and later evolved into painting.

After a detour through architecture, where structure and logic were central, Gombault returned to a more intuitive and expressive practice. Traveling through unknown environments reawakened his creative energy, leading to a renewed focus on world-building—not physically, but visually and conceptually.

His work reflects fragments of emotion, memory, and observation, exploring the tension between the organic and the digital, the imagined and the imposed. Each painting functions as a window into a parallel universe: intimate and shared simultaneously.

With his practice, Gombault invites the viewer into what he describes as “the bubble”: an autonomous reality shaped by perception, emotion, and imagination.
